How Much Do Private Club Venues in Chennai Cost?

Pricing for private club venues in Chennai follows a layered structure that couples should understand before comparing quotes. The venue rental alone typically ranges from INR 50,000 to INR 2,50,000 for a half-day indoor booking, and INR 1,50,000 to INR 5,00,000 for a full campus or overnight event. Exclusive club banquet halls in premium localities like Boat Club Road or Cathedral Road command the higher end of this range. Wedding catering packages Chennai clubs offer can add INR 800 to INR 2,500 per plate depending on cuisine style, number of courses, and live-counter choices. Many clubs include basic tables, chairs, and a service team in the rental, which reduces your additional vendor spend significantly. Security deposits, electricity surcharges, generator backup costs, and corkage fees — if you bring outside beverages — are common add-ons that inflate the final invoice by 15–25%, so always request an all-inclusive breakup in writing.

What Should You Check Before Finalising a Private Club Venue in Chennai?

Due diligence before signing a booking agreement for private club venues protects your budget and your event experience. First, verify whether the club requires either the bride or groom's family to hold membership, or whether the venue is open to non-members at a higher tariff — policies vary widely across Chennai clubs. Second, confirm the club's noise curfew, as most Chennai residential neighbourhoods enforce a 10 PM limit that directly affects live band sets and DJ schedules. Third, inspect the power backup arrangement; a seamless generator that switches in under 30 seconds is the minimum acceptable standard for events with elaborate festive decor and lighting themes. Fourth, review the exclusive club banquet halls' approved vendor list — some clubs restrict outside caterers, florists, or sound companies, which can limit your creative choices and inflate costs. Finally, ensure that the banquet hall with outdoor lawn has lockable storage for gifts, cash envelopes, and personal items, as large social gatherings in Chennai are unfortunately not immune to pilferage.

People Also Ask

Can non-members book private club venues in Chennai?
Many Chennai clubs allow non-members to book private club venues if sponsored by an existing member or at a higher non-member tariff. Policies differ significantly — some clubs open their halls freely for commercial bookings, while others strictly require a current member to sign the booking form. Always confirm the membership policy before investing time in a site visit.
What is the typical guest capacity of club venues for weddings in Chennai?
Club venues for weddings in Chennai generally accommodate between 50 and 1,500 guests depending on the specific hall or lawn being booked. Inner-city clubs average 150–400 for indoor functions, while suburban clubs with large grounds can comfortably host 800 to 1,200 guests for an outdoor reception with a marquee tent.
Are exclusive club banquet halls in Chennai available during peak wedding season?
Peak wedding season in Chennai runs from October to February, aligning with auspicious Tamil and Telugu muhurtham dates. Exclusive club banquet halls get booked three to six months in advance during this period. Booking by May or June for a December or January wedding is strongly advised. Weekday bookings during peak season have better availability and sometimes lower pricing.
Do club wedding reception venues in Chennai allow outside caterers?
Some club wedding reception venues in Chennai permit outside caterers subject to a kitchen surcharge and prior approval, while others insist exclusively on their in-house culinary team. If authentic Brahmin, Chettinad, or specific regional cuisine is important to your family, clarify outside catering rights before finalising the venue to avoid last-minute surprises.
Which areas in Chennai have the best private club venues?
Chennai's private club venues are concentrated in Nungambakkam, Adyar, Anna Nagar, T. Nagar, and Mylapore for central access. ECR and OMR corridors offer newer clubs with larger lawns and more parking. North Chennai near Kolathur has a growing number of affordable members club event spaces suitable for traditional weddings on mid-range budgets.
How far in advance should I do wedding venue booking in Chennai for a club?
For wedding venue booking in Chennai at a private club, aim to secure your date at least four to six months before the event for off-peak months and six to nine months ahead for peak season. Popular clubs with a single main hall often have only 8–12 weekend dates available per quarter, so early booking is essential.
What are the noise and timing restrictions at Chennai club venues?
Most Chennai club venues adhere to Tamil Nadu Pollution Control Board guidelines, capping amplified music at 10 PM in residential zones. Some clubs on independent plots allow events until midnight. Always get the permitted hours, decibel limits, and any penalty clauses in writing before signing the agreement to protect your DJ or live music plans.
Are there club venues in Chennai that offer both a banquet hall with outdoor lawn?
Yes, several Chennai clubs offer a banquet hall with outdoor lawn as a combined package, allowing indoor dining alongside outdoor cocktail or sangeet setups. This hybrid format is particularly popular for November-to-February weddings when Chennai evenings are cool and pleasant. Confirm lawn dimensions, tent permission, and floor-load capacity for heavy decor structures.
